DESCRIPTION:\n	Followed by discussion with editor Keith Fraase \n	\n	\n\nDi
 r. Terrence Malick. 2012\, 113 mins. 35mm. With Olga Kurylenko\, Ben Affle
 ck\, Rachel McAdams\, Javier Bardem. Malick’s under-appreciated follow-up 
 to The Tree of Life marks an era of his work defined by a fidelity to an u
 nscripted\, unrehearsed\, caught-on-the-wing approach he’d incorporated in
 to his shoots since The Thin Red Line. An American man (Affleck) and a Eur
 opean single mother (Kurylenko in an effervescent turn) fall madly in love
  in Paris. Returning with her daughter to his native Oklahoma and the prom
 ise of a new life together\, the woman quickly grows despondent\, the man 
 absent\, amid the remote\, unpopulated surroundings of house and fence\, f
 arm and field. Taking up with his former sweetheart (McAdams)\, the man on
 ly grows more distant\, while his increasingly isolated partner seeks sola
 ce in the councils of a local priest (Bardem). The first of a trilogy of w
 orks that turn Malick’s rapturously all-embracing eye upon the contemporar
 y world\, this lament for lost lovers finds as much astonishment in the ap
 parition of a Sonic drive-in as Mont-Saint-Michel. \n\n\nFollowed by:&nbsp
 \;Thy Kingdom Come&nbsp\; \n\n   (2018\, 42 mins.)\, photographer Eugene R
 ichards’s spun-off collaboration with Javier Bardem. Shot concurrently wit
 h To the Wonder\, this experimental hybrid of documentary and fiction witn
 esses Bardem’s Father Quintana pursuing real-life conversations with the p
 eople of Osage County\, from myriad family homes to a trailer park\, a pri
